In Keating and across the Lower Mainland–Southwest, you can easily see driveway quotes swing by 30–50% for what looks like the same job. The biggest reason is that contractors price “site readiness” rather than just surface material: excavation volume, whether the base is rebuilt to spec, how drainage is corrected, and how much extra labour is needed to keep edges from failing when it rains hard. A second common driver is timing—work is booked tightly in spring and summer because hot-mix asphalt relies on air temperatures above about 10°C to place properly, and scheduling pressure can tighten lead times and labour availability.
Frost line depth still matters here, even though coastal BC is milder than Ontario/Alberta. Where deeper frost or weaker, clay-heavy subgrades are present, you need thicker compacted granular base (often in the 6–12 inch range in colder regions, with coastal BC commonly less than that when soils are stable). In parts of the Fraser Valley, saturated clay or poor drainage can act like “effective frost,” driving heaving and cracking. That’s why a well-built base and drainage strategy is what keeps a driveway within the typical asphalt band of $12 – $20 per sq ft rather than sliding toward “rebuild costs” after a couple of wet winters.
For concrete, costs can rise when contractors must add air-entrainment and control joints correctly, plus do more subbase stabilization. Pavers can reduce long-term replacement risk, but the edge restraints and bedding layer are labour-heavy—so if your quote starts in the paver range of $20 – $40 per sq ft, ask whether the contractor included proper excavation, bedding sand, and jointing.

In British Columbia, paving a private driveway within your own property usually does not require a building permit. Most homeowners in Keating can replace a surface (for example, asphalt over a prepared base, or pavers/concrete on their lot) without a permit, as long as the work stays off municipal infrastructure and does not alter drainage leading to the right-of-way.
However, work may require municipal approval when it touches the municipal right-of-way or impacts how stormwater is managed. Typical examples include: new or modified curb cuts, changes to boulevard areas, altering side ditches or catch basins, rerouting or connecting drainage that discharges into the municipal system, or any grading that changes how water flows near the road or sidewalk. Some municipalities also enforce lot-grading bylaws that restrict how close a hard surface can sit to property lines or how water must be handled.
Step-by-step, here’s how a homeowner in Keating can verify a contractor properly in BC: (1) ask for their BC business/contractor licence info (where applicable for paving, the contractor should be transparent about their legal entity), (2) request a certificate of insurance showing they have liability coverage, and confirm the policy includes your address as an “additional insured” when your contract requires it, and (3) ask for proof of work coverage—workers’ compensation coverage documentation for their crews (coverage is commonly referenced in contracts as WSBC/WCB coverage). Then check the certificate expiry dates before any work begins, and keep copies with your contract and scope.
For Keating driveways, all three surfaces can work—but they fail differently in the Lower Mainland–Southwest climate. Asphalt is the lowest upfront option and typically lands in the $12 – $20 per sq ft range when the base is properly rebuilt. Its key requirement is routine sealing every 3–5 years; without it, the binder weathers and rain water penetrates, accelerating cracking along wheel paths. Asphalt also tends to be more sensitive to poor edge drainage, which can matter during shoulder-season downpours.
Interlocking concrete pavers cost the most upfront, usually in the $20 – $40 per sq ft band, but they offer the best curb appeal and the most repair flexibility. If a driveway section needs attention due to settling or a drainage issue, pavers can be lifted, corrected, and reset—without tearing out the entire surface. That repairability is valuable where clayey soils or localized saturation show up after heavy rain.
Poured concrete is a mid-range choice (often around the $18 – $35 per sq ft band) but must be correctly air-entrained and jointed. Freeze–thaw movement in BC, combined with rain and occasional de-icing (where homeowners use salt near edges), can contribute to cracking if the mix and finishing aren’t right. Exposed aggregate improves slip resistance but still needs proper base and joints. In salt/plow-heavy driveways, maintenance discipline and joint spacing become the difference between “cracks in a few years” and “holds up much longer.”

Choosing a contractor in Keating starts with verifying the right paperwork and then matching the quote to the real site conditions. In British Columbia, ask for proof of liability insurance—request a certificate of insurance and confirm it covers paving/excavation activities at your address. For crew coverage, verify they have the appropriate workers’ compensation coverage documents for their employees (coverage is commonly referred to under BC’s workers’ compensation system). Don’t accept “we’re insured” without documentation you can read: look for policy numbers, effective dates, and limits.
Next, get 2–3 itemised written quotes that break down labour and materials (excavation, base gravel, bedding sand if pavers, asphalt/concrete, restraints, disposal, compaction testing if used, and sealing if asphalt). Avoid lump-sum quotes that don’t describe base depth, grading/drainage correction, or what will happen to existing edges and curb connections. Confirm whether the permit/approval process is included if your job affects the municipal right-of-way or storm drainage (even if a permit isn’t typical for private-lot paving, approval may still apply for curb cuts or drainage changes).
Warranty matters: ask for the workmanship warranty length in plain language, and whether product warranties apply to materials (and how they’re handled). Payment schedule should be conservative—typically never more than 10–15% upfront; hold back until key milestones are complete (especially base inspection and final surface cure/clean-up). Get a start date and a completion estimate in writing, along with weather contingencies because Lower Mainland–Southwest rain can pause asphalt and concrete placements.
Red flags in Keating: a contractor who won’t specify base depth or drainage steps; quotes that only compare surface thickness without addressing soil conditions; “cash only” or unclear payment terms; refusal to provide insurance/work coverage documents; and warranties that are vague (no time period or no workmanship details).

For asphalt in Keating and the Lower Mainland–Southwest, late spring to early fall is usually the best window. Hot-mix asphalt placement depends on air temperatures (commonly above 10°C) so contractors can properly compact the mix and get a stable surface. Shoulder-season rain can also limit workable days, particularly after heavy storms when subgrades are saturated. For concrete, placement is easiest in dry, mild weather so finishing and curing can be controlled. If you’re comparing quotes, try to schedule base work and grading early, because the drainage and compaction stages set the foundation for everything that follows. Your contractor should provide a written schedule and note weather contingencies in the contract.
Keating’s frost is generally less intense than inland BC, but cost-effective longevity still requires building the base below the effective freeze–thaw zone for sensitive applications. In practice, most good residential asphalt jobs use about 6 inches of compacted granular base (with additional excavation and stabilization if soils are weak or saturated). If the subgrade is clayey or holds water, contractors may need to remove unsuitable material and replace with appropriate granular layers to prevent pumping, rutting, and heaving. The exact base depth should be stated in your quote based on the site’s soil and drainage observations. A contractor who won’t specify base depth is a problem—because frost line depth matters, but so does local saturation and drainage (Lower Mainland–Southwest drainage emphasis).
For Keating driveways, sealing is typically recommended every 3–5 years, depending on traffic and how much rain and UV exposure the surface gets. After a new asphalt placement, sealing is usually done after the pavement has properly cured—often after about 6–12 months. If you skip sealing, the binder can deteriorate faster, which shows up as surface raveling, fine cracking, and water penetration that accelerates edge failure. If you’re trying to budget, sealing is one of the least expensive maintenance steps relative to full replacement. When you receive a quote for asphalt around the $12 – $20 per sq ft band, ask whether sealing is included in the scope or if it’s a separate planned maintenance item.
In Keating and much of the Lower Mainland–Southwest, cracking and heaving are often symptoms of water movement rather than “just frost.” When water infiltrates the driveway—through edges, low spots, or poorly drained subgrade—it can freeze during cold snaps and expand slightly. Repeated freeze–thaw cycles around a shallow effective frost line can lift weak sections, especially where soils are clay-heavy or where the base wasn’t compacted and drained correctly. Common triggers include inadequate slopes, missing edge restraints, and base materials that weren’t installed to the right thickness. If you’ve had visible puddling after rain, the fix is usually drainage and base rebuild, not just patching the surface. Patches can buy time, but persistent heave typically means the underlying water problem remains.
